Painting – Lupine Pups

Description:
Over a period of four weeks, students will develop and apply an understanding of the elements of art through acrylic painting. Through a variety of exercises, students will develop an array of paint application techniques, all while learning how to develop their own original work.

Week One – Learning the Basics
An introduction of materials such as paint, medium and different types of brushes.
Colour Theory – Making our own colour wheel by learning how to mix colours.

The younger pups will be making their own colour wheel, and learning about the different colour schemes, warm and cool colours and how to mix paint. Students will be provided with activities and information to pursue at home in their workbooks.

The older pups will be doing the same activities as well as a value scale, and learning about hue and value, colour matching as well.

Week Two – Layers and Texture
Learning about paint application and the magic of layers and texture!

The younger pups will be focusing on texture and paint application while learning about past and present abstract artists.

The older pups will be learning about effective ways to apply paint, layer, and create texture while exploring elements of art such as line, shape, form, colour, texture, space and value.
We will be discussing and exploring how acrylic mediums can help us achieve finished works.

Week Three – The not so still life! A focus on process
This lesson will focus on the process of developing a painting. We will be learning about how to go from idea to finished painting. Working from a simple still life, we will be making some sketches, talking about composition, choosing our palettes, and transferring our vision to canvas.

The older pups will also be discussing and brainstorming ways that we can incorporate elements of art and design into our work to make them dynamic and interesting.

Week Four – Ready to fly! Bringing it all together
This week the younger pups will be either be finishing up their still life or beginning a self directed work with a subject of their own choosing.

This week the older pups will be working a self directed work with a subject of their own choosing, with a focus on incorporating the elements of art and design.
